need help
how do i create an underwater track? i have placed checkpoints under water i also made the rider and bike invulnerable and allowed 10 buoyancy for both. yet when i ride through the track i cannot hold a nose manual or ride slow because it pushes the bike down and backwards. especially when i am in the air. i tried everything and its getting frustrating. how do i make it so it feels like the same outside of the water, i just want the environment
-
Re: need help
Probably the best bet is to use your own water not the world water. I had the same problem with what your having but when i grabbed the ''water - square planes'' i no longer had that problem. Everything is natural.. except the fact your driving under water lol

i need help making the bike disappear halfway through the track,
any suggestion on how i could do this?
-
Re: need help
I'm not sure if you can do it with a visibility event, i've never tried. but tying the bike's visibility to a variable data source and then using a set variable event will work. 1=checked 0 =unchecked
Edit: Set value event. Not set variable, I had a brain fart. There is no such thing, lol
